FC Barcelona managed to secure an important win against Real Valladolid last night despite Hansi Flick choosing to majorly rotate the starting XI. Barcelona were trailing 1-0 in the first half, but goals from Raphinha and Fermin Lopez helped the team perform yet another comeback.

Flick chose to rest the 9/11 players who started midweek against Inter Milan in the Champions League, with Gerard Martin and Pedri being the only exceptions. Among those changes was a first start for Marc-Andre Ter Stegen since September, replacing Wojciech Szczesny in goal.

Club captain Ter Stegen has been out with an injury since September and has only recently made a complete recovery. In his absence, Barcelona made an emergency signing in Szczesny, who has ended up enjoying a brilliant campaign since the start of 2025.

With Ter Stegen now fit, it has been a question on everyone’s lips about who Hansi Flick would prefer going forward in between the sticks. In the Champions League, it has already been confirmed that the Pole will continue, especially since the German is currently not registered.

Hansi Flick Confirms Szczesny Will Start vs Inter and Real Madrid

When asked about the goalkeeping situation last night in the post-match press conference, as quoted by Mundo Deportivo, Hansi Flick has confirmed that Szczesny will remain in goal against both Inter Milan midweek and Real Madrid next weekend.

“Szczesny will be the goalkeeper on Tuesday against Inter Milan and also against Real Madrid.”

Szczesny’s Form Justifies the Decision

One would have to say at this point that Flick has made the right decision. Szczesny has been brilliant since the start of 2025 and is arguably the second-best in the world based on form, only after PSG goalkeeper Donnarumma.

As the age-old adage in the coding world goes, “When it ain’t broken, don’t fix it”. The goalkeeping situation at Barcelona is not broken at the moment, and it is only fair that the Pole continues to hold fort until the end of the season.

Once Barcelona wrap up the title, one can expect Ter Stegen to feature more as he looks to build his match fitness, and let’s wait and see how it plays out.
